Halcyon House overlooks the turquoise waters and beautiful sunsets located on the southwest shoreline reserve of Lubbers Quarters within The Abaco Ocean Club. Currently the layout offers a true 2-bedroom and 2-bathroom home with a comfortable open floor plan but can easily be retrofitted into 3 bedrooms. It has large covered decks overlooking the Sea of Abaco and would make a great vacation rental property with shared dock access right at your doorstep. Upstairs there is 1-bedroom and 1 bath with the open living currently also offering addition sleep quarters. The dining and kitchen area, plus 1-bedroom and 1-bathroom are on lower level that also looks out to the Sea of Abaco. Fully furnished, 15KW back-up generator, outdoor shower and shared dockage adjacent the house, plus community dockage on East side of island just a short cart ride away. Dylan Christie was raised in Nassau, Bahamas, and attended St. Andrews School. At 13 years old he left the Bahamas to attend IMG Academy in Bradenton, Florida, a leading sports academy to play soccer. He then attended Jacksonville University to play division one (1) soccer and study Finance and Business Management. After four (4) successful years at Jacksonville University, Dylan graduated with a Bachelor of Arts degree in Finance and Business Management receiving a Maga Cum Laude distinction, accepted into two (2) honor societies and selected by Advantage Business Magazine as a 2016 top 40 student at the Davis College of Business. Dylan always had a passion for Real Estate and shortly after graduating started working at commercial real estate mortgage firms including NorthMarq Capital and Greystone located in Jacksonville and New York City, respectively. Dylan was responsible for originating, underwriting, and other due diligence support functions to fund over $700 million of commercial real estate loans for multifamily and retail assets through various debt platforms. Out of the office, Dylan enjoys sailing, playing soccer, various fitness activities, skiing and fishing. He represented the Bahamas on the international level during the FIFA U-17 world cup qualifiers and was the 2007 Optimist sailing national champion of the Bahamas. Dylan is excited to be joining the family company on the 100th year anniversary and help continue to grow the company to new heights as the longest standing top selling firm in the Bahamas.
